    Abstract: An internal combustion engine (10) comprises an engine block (12) defining a cylinder (14) having a longitudinal axis A. A piston (16) is arranged slidably within the cylinder 14 and an impeller 18 is arranged at one end of the cylinder (14). The impeller (18) is rotatably mounted on a shaft (30), which extends out of the cylinder (14) and which is driven in rotation by rotation of the impeller (18). The engine further comprises an anti- rotation formation (20) to prevent the piston rotating about a longitudinal axis of the cylinder and a swirl-inducing vane (38) arranged on the face of the piston which faces the end of the cylinder at which the impeller is arranged. Combustion gas generated by combustion of a fuel in the cylinder between the piston and the impeller is caused to swirl by reaction with the swirl-inducing vane and the swirling combustion gases, in turn, cause the impeller to rotate.

    Abstract: Various embodiments of the present invention are directed toward a linear combustion engine, comprising: a cylinder having a cylinder wall and a pair of ends, the cylinder including a combustion section disposed in a center portion of the cylinder; a pair of opposed piston assemblies adapted to move linearly within the cylinder, each piston assembly disposed on one side of the combustion section opposite the other piston assembly, each piston assembly including a spring rod and a piston comprising a solid front section adjacent the combustion section and a gas section; and a pair of linear electromagnetic machines adapted to directly convert kinetic energy of the piston assembly into electrical energy, and adapted to directly convert electrical energy into kinetic energy of the piston assembly for providing compression work during the compression stroke.

    Abstract: In a pneumatic engine provided with a piston (2), a piston rod (3) and a piston slide parallel and capable for example of driving piston pump used for atomizing or spraying paints, the slide (13) is actuated by the piston rod (3) towards the end of each stroke of the piston (2) by means of an inversion device. The inversion device comprises an actuating member which effects a reciprocating motion between two stops (18, 19) fixed on the slide. In order to accelerate the inversion of the slide as well as to simplify and reduce the required force for the inversion of the slide, the inversion device comprises only one lever (21) of which the free end is connected to the piston rod (3) by means of a traction spring (29). This freed end of the lever (21) is the actuating member which give pulses to the slide (13) upon running against the stop (18, 19) with individual adjustment. The lever may be a handle supported on both sides and of which the central part forms the actuating member.

    Abstract: A gas driven oscillator (10) comprising an engine (11) having a cylinder (12) and a pair of expansion chambers (13, 14) on either side of a floating piston (15) adapted to reciprocate within the cylinder (12). The piston (15) is mounted on a piston rod (16) extending through the cylinder (12) and into a compressor (17). Compressed air is delivered from a tank (20) to the engine (11) via a pair of valves (22, 23) mounted on an adjustment screw and slidably disposed on the piston rod (16). The spacing between the valves (22, 23) can be adjusted in order to vary the amplitude of the piston (15) within the cylinder (12). The piston rod (16) includes spaced slots (24, 25) which alternately align with passages inside the respective valves (22, 23) to deliver a pulse of compressed air to the respective chambers (13, 14) of the cylinder (12). Mercury is added to or discharged from a tank (42) which is rigidly secured to piston rod (16) to vary the inertia of the oscillator (10).

    Abstract: An internal combustion engine may include an engine block, a cylinder defining a combustion chamber, and a piston in the cylinder, The piston may travel in a first stroke from one end to an opposite end of the cylinder, and may be sized relative to the cylinder to enable an expansion stroke portion of the first stroke while the piston travels under gas expansion pressure, and a momentum stroke portion of the first stroke for the remainder of the first stroke following the expansion stroke portion. A piston rod portion may be connected to the piston and extend from a location within the combustion chamber to an area external to the cylinder, A recess in the piston rod portion may form a passageway to continuously communicate gas flow between the combustion chamber and the area external to the cylinder when the piston is in the momentum stroke portion.
